Notice to Individual Property 0w»ers of ue <br />Assessment Hearing and of their Individual <br />Assessment Amoui t <br />At its April 1 work session City Council made a number of <br />determinations concerning the Stubbs Bay sewer project. <br />A.The Council determined that all proposed project <br />areas be included in the project. The only <br />‘.ential exception is the Oxford area, which can be <br />excluded if all properties are able to meet the <br />exclusion criteria. <br />B.The Council also determined that the proposed <br />assessment roll should reflect a 30% city <br />participation level. <br />Staff is recommending two exceptions to the 30% <br />participation level. Both relate to vacant properties: <br />city <br />! .Those vacant lots that were not buildable with <br />septic but which become buildable with sewer, should <br />be assessed at 100% of the unit cost. This <br />recommendation is based on .he very large benefit <br />provided by the creation of a new lot. <br />2.For those properties where sewer a ^'a i lab i 1 i ty <br />enables an additional lot or lots through a <br />subdivision the potential additiona? lots should not <br />be assessed at this time. The property owners <br />should pay a connection charge equal to 100% of the <br />cost per sewer unit at the time of the subdivision. <br />This recommendation is based on the large benefit <br />provided by the creation of a new lot. This <br />recommendation also enables the city to avoid making <br />any commitments regarding potential additional lots <br />at this time. <br />V , v,‘ •'
